CVE-2026-71518: Typemill < 2.26.0 Authorization Bypass via Media File Download Route
Typemill before 2.26.0 contains an authorization bypass vulnerability in the media file download route that allows unauthenticated attackers to access restricted files by submitting path-equivalent URL variants. Attackers can substitute normalized path forms such as dot-slash prefixes, double slashes, or percent-encoded sequences to pass role-based restriction checks while the filesystem resolves the request to the protected file, enabling unauthorized file download without credentials.

What is the severity of CVE-2026-71518?
The severity of CVE-2026-71518 is rated high with a CVSS score of 7.5.
What is the impact of CVE-2026-71518?
CVE-2026-71518 allows unauthenticated attackers to access restricted files through an authorization bypass in the media file download route.
How do I fix CVE-2026-71518?
To fix CVE-2026-71518, upgrade Typemill to version 2.26.0 or later.
